What did you gain/learn from your experience abroad? Was it worthwhile?
I felt as though I gained a lot from the experience of living in a foreign city. The school itself was underwhelming from an academic standpoint.

If you could do it all over again would you choose the same program? No

I would choose a more rigorous school in Paris, like Science Po.

* What do you know now that you wish you knew before going on this program? I wish I knew that you would interact with very few Parisians while going to AUP, as most of the student body is international students.
